Pros

Very casual setting with no real dress code. The office is nice and in a neat part of the Heights. The original owners were awesome and really made the place a good environment to work in. Leadership in the beginning was not bad but could have been improved a bit. Training was short and mostly on the job style training. Benefits are not bad. The company is well valued by its employees and customers.

Cons

The new owner/CEO is more worried about sales numbers and not the employees that keep the place running, it is clear this is the first real company that the CEO has run. This is a 100% technology/web driven business with NO consideration or thought about the back-end technology keeping the day to day business and applications running. New management would rather nickle and dime every aspect of technology upgrades so it can be spent on un-needed sales territories and consultants. Management would rather hire from outside, than from within. Pay and compensation for employees is sub-par and not even close to industry standards. Open door policy is talked about but your concerns will never be addressed or just flat out ignored. The company is a software company, yet cannot deliver software updates because management refuses to hire new developers. You will be un-knowingly volunteered to work after hours and on weekends, yet no appreciation or compensation is given. You will be required to perform 3 peoples jobs ALL at the same time while not getting payed anything extra for your efforts. Upper management never acknowledges success but will drill you into the ground at even the slightest mistake, making a scene in front of the entire company.
